What is environmental education?

Environmental education is an educational process that helps develop awareness and understanding of environmental issues, encouraging responsible and sustainable behaviour towards the environment. This process seeks to build the skills, values and attitudes needed to understand both current and future environmental challenges.

Environmental education helps students understand the connection and interdependence between human beings and the environment. This involves promoting sustainable practices in all areas of life, including at home, at work, in education and during leisure time.

Environmental education can include different types of educational initiatives, such as formal and informal teaching programmes, awareness and outreach campaigns, outdoor activities, workshops and more.

Environmental education is a comprehensive educational process that aims to develop knowledge of the environment while encouraging responsible and sustainable behaviour. It is essential in addressing environmental challenges and building a more sustainable and fairer future for everyone.

The aims of environmental education

The main objective of environmental education is to raise awareness of environmental issues. To achieve this, it is important to work towards the following goals:

  • Encouraging respect for the environment as a fundamental resource for human life and the wellbeing of all species.
  • Promoting sustainable habits and practices in everyday routines related to food, transport, consumption and waste management.
  • Developing the skills needed to identify and analyse environmental problems, and to make decisions focused on finding solutions.
  • Encouraging participation in volunteering and community engagement activities.
  • Developing a critical understanding of environmental policies, practices and technologies, while encouraging reflection on their social impact.

The importance of raising awareness among future generations

Raising awareness among future generations about respect for the environment is crucial to ensuring a sustainable future for our planet and for all the species that inhabit it. Environmental education from an early age is essential so that students understand the importance of the environment and the need to protect it.

Teaching children and young people about environmental problems, and how to prevent or solve them, is key to encouraging ecological practices. If young people understand the importance of caring for the environment and the consequences of failing to do so, they are more likely to take positive action and contribute to change.

Respect for the environment is a fundamental value for the sustainable development of society. In an increasingly interconnected world, environmental degradation has global effects and impacts all communities, including future generations. Environmental education can be a highly effective tool for encouraging cooperation and solidarity, with the aim of building a fairer and more sustainable future.

Schools have a responsibility when it comes to the environmental education of their students. Raising awareness among future generations about respect for the environment is essential to ensuring a sustainable future.

Another advantage of our school in relation to environmental education is that we are part of the Eco-Schools network. The Eco-Schools network is an educational programme that aims to promote environmental education and sustainability in schools across different countries around the world. This programme encourages the active participation of students, teachers and school staff in the environmental management of the school, the promotion of healthy and sustainable lifestyles and the development of environmental improvement projects.
